Richard Henderson <richard.henderson@linaro.org> writes:

> Reorg everything using QEMU_GENERIC and multiple inclusion to
> reduce the amount of code duplication between the formats.
>
> The use of QEMU_GENERIC means that we need to use pointers instead
> of structures, which means that even the smaller float formats
> need rearranging.
>
> I've carried it through to completion within fpu/, so that we don't
> have (much) of the legacy code remaining.  There is some floatx80
> stuff in target/m68k and target/i386 that's still hanging around.

OK and here are some quad benchmarks. There is actual change above the
noise but I think the biggest hit comes from the parts conversion but we
do claw some of it back:
